Civil Aviation Department

The Civil Aviation function is responsible for the development, implementation and supervision of aviation policy, legislation and applicable international requirements in Sint Maarten.

RESPONSIBILITIES

Core Aviation Responsibilities

Airport Matters

Advising on matters concerning airports and related transport and telecommunication services.

Policy & Legislation

Responsibility for aviation policy, laws and legislation and supervision of their implementation.

Aviation Policy Coordination

Coordinating aviation policy with ministries, Kingdom partners, independent governing bodies and private agencies.

Aviation Register

Management of the Aviation Register of Sint Maarten.

Safety & Compliance

Supervision of compliance with applicable laws, legislation and international treaties.

Aero-Technical & Operational Activities

Oversight of applicable aero-technical and operational activities of government and private aviation organizations.

Safe and Effective Aviation

The Department of Civil Aviation, Shipping and Maritime Affairs performs the civil aviation authority function for Sint Maarten and oversees applicable aviation safety, security and operational requirements.
